summaryrefslogtreecommitdiff
path: root/odk/examples
diff options
context:
space:
mode:
authorJens-Heiner Rechtien <hr@openoffice.org>2005-10-24 17:27:50 +0000
committerJens-Heiner Rechtien <hr@openoffice.org>2005-10-24 17:27:50 +0000
commit223e87524f9250ca350666f81ecea60c35456001 (patch)
tree644fa76d2f2aa9c6f5cc89fd6883994c5caa84d8 /odk/examples
parent6759b452e489b7324017cb9cf2774c005e304305 (diff)
INTEGRATION: CWS lo8 (1.5.28); FILE MERGED
2005/08/23 12:12:26 lo 1.5.28.1: #113679# master docuemnt and better oasis support
Diffstat (limited to 'odk/examples')
-rw-r--r--odk/examples/DevelopersGuide/OfficeDev/FilterDevelopment/FlatXmlFilterDetection/filterdetect.cxx29
1 files changed, 19 insertions, 10 deletions
diff --git a/odk/examples/DevelopersGuide/OfficeDev/FilterDevelopment/FlatXmlFilterDetection/filterdetect.cxx b/odk/examples/DevelopersGuide/OfficeDev/FilterDevelopment/FlatXmlFilterDetection/filterdetect.cxx
index 9b3490850dff..83f8b798cf6f 100644
--- a/odk/examples/DevelopersGuide/OfficeDev/FilterDevelopment/FlatXmlFilterDetection/filterdetect.cxx
+++ b/odk/examples/DevelopersGuide/OfficeDev/FilterDevelopment/FlatXmlFilterDetection/filterdetect.cxx
@@ -2,9 +2,9 @@
*
* $RCSfile: filterdetect.cxx,v $
*
- * $Revision: 1.5 $
+ * $Revision: 1.6 $
*
- * last change: $Author: rt $ $Date: 2005-01-31 16:45:21 $
+ * last change: $Author: hr $ $Date: 2005-10-24 18:27:50 $
*
* The Contents of this file are made available subject to the terms of
* the BSD license.
@@ -202,17 +202,26 @@ OUString SAL_CALL FilterDetect::detect(Sequence< PropertyValue >& aArguments )
n += aMimeTypeToken.getLength();
OString aMimeType = aHead.copy(n, aHead.indexOf('\"', n) - n);
// return type for class found
- if (aMimeType.equals("application/x-vnd.oasis.openoffice.text") ||
- aMimeType.equals("application/vnd.oasis.openoffice.text"))
+ if (aMimeType.equals("application/x-vnd.oasis.opendocument.text")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.text"))
s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_writer");
- else if (aMimeType.equals("application/x-vnd.oasis.openoffice.spreadsheet") ||
- aMimeType.equals("application/vnd.oasis.openoffice.spreadsheet"))
+ else if (aMimeType.equals("application/x-vnd.oasis.opendocument.text-master")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.text-master"))
+ s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_master");
+ else if (aMimeType.equals("application/x-vnd.oasis.openoffice.text-global") ||
+ aMimeType.equals("application/vnd.oasis.openoffice.text-global"))
+ s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_master");
+ else if (aMimeType.equals("application/x-vnd.oasis.opendocument.spreadsheet")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.spreadsheet"))
s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_calc");
- else if (aMimeType.equals("application/x-vnd.oasis.openoffice.drawing") ||
- aMimeType.equals("application/vnd.oasis.openoffice.drawing"))
+ else if (aMimeType.equals("application/x-vnd.oasis.opendocument.drawing")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.drawing"))
s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_draw");
- else if (aMimeType.equals("application/x-vnd.oasis.openoffice.presentation") ||
- aMimeType.equals("application/vnd.oasis.openoffice.presentation"))
+ else if (aMimeType.equals("application/x-vnd.oasis.opendocument.presentation")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.presentation"))
+ s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_impress");
+ else if (aMimeType.equals("application/x-vnd.oasis.opendocument.presentation") ||
+ aMimeType.equals("application/vnd.oasis.opendocument.presentation"))
sTypeName = OUString::createFromAscii("devguide_FlatXMLType_Cpp_impress");
}
}